Army Troops Buy Jaffna-Grown Vegetables & Fruits for Distribution

A project to sell Jaffna-grown vegetables and fruits directly to all Army personnel serving the Security Force HQ - Jaffna and elsewhere in a bid to foster goodwill and reconciliation efforts between farmers and Security Forces began on Friday (12) in Jaffna on the guidelines given by General Shavendra Silva, Chief of Defence Staff and Commander of the Army.

The project facilitated by the Directorate of Supply and Transport at the Army HQ saw fresh vegetables, bought from vegetable growers in Jaffna taken to Army families, residing in the peninsula for sale.

With the close coordination of SFHQ-J, those stocks were distributed among Army troops at subsidized rates on Friday (12) with the arrangements, made by Major General Priyantha Perera, Commander, Security Forces - Jaffna. Troops consider the project would help both Army personnel and farming communities in the peninsula in the long run.

In addition, some stocks were also to be dispatched to Colombo area for distribution on a regular basis after educating Army personnel on the planned welfare measure.

This programme was implemented under the guidance and direction of the Commander, Security Forces - Jaffna, Major General Priyantha Perera and under the supervision of Director, Supply and Transport, AHQ Commanding Officer, 5 Sri Lanka Army Service Corps.
